Learning Community/Hybrid Course: Writing For The Movies If you love movies and have dreams of being a writer, then this learning community is perfect for you! As we study film history, exploring concepts like Classical Hollywood Style, the Studio System, the Rise and Fall and Rise Again of Hollywood, and Postmodernism in Film, we will create poems, short fiction pieces, and a screenplay in response to our shared viewing experiences, lectures, readings, and discussions. This course combines ENGL&236 – Creative Writing I and HIST 120 – History Of The Movies for 10 credits.
